About the Role

Join our Volunteer Services team and keep things running smoothly across three vibrant sites. You’ll manage admin flow, build strong connections, create clear records, and maintain efficient systems that support our volunteers and staff every day.

Duties
• Provide admin support across three sites
• Manage records, data, and documents
• Build strong relationships with volunteers and staff
• Coordinate enquiries and communication
• Maintain accurate systems and files
• Support daily team priorities

About You

You’re organised, approachable, and thrive in a busy setting. You bring strong admin know-how, communicate with care, and build positive connections with ease while keeping work accurate, timely, and confidential.

• Experience in admin support, ideally in health care
• Strong Microsoft Office and data entry skills
• Communicate clearly with staff, volunteers, public
• Prioritise tasks, meet deadlines, keep accuracy
• Work well solo and in a team across sites

The Central Adelaide Local Health Network includes:


  • Royal Adelaide Hospital
  • Hampstead Rehabilitation Hospital
  • The Queen Elizabeth Hospital
  • Glenside Health Services
  • SA Dental Services
  • Statewide Services including Breastscreen SA, Prison Health Services, SA Pathology, SA Medical Imaging and SA Pharmacy.
